中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

詳解php用static方法的原因

PHP
小云
101
2023-08-11 12:22:41
欄目: 編程語言

PHP中的靜態方法是指在類中定義的可以直接通過類名調用的方法,而不需要實例化類對象。使用靜態方法的主要原因有以下幾點:

  1. 訪問類成員:靜態方法可以直接訪問類中的靜態成員變量和靜態方法,而不需要創建類的實例。這樣可以方便地在沒有創建對象的情況下調用類中的方法和屬性。

  2. 共享數據:靜態方法可以訪問和修改靜態成員變量,這些變量在類的所有實例中是共享的。這樣可以實現在多個對象之間共享數據的目的。

  3. 提高性能:由于靜態方法不需要實例化類對象,所以在調用靜態方法時無需創建對象,從而減少了內存和時間的消耗。這在需要頻繁調用某個方法時可以提高程序的性能。

  4. 便于封裝:靜態方法可以在類的內部使用,用于封裝一些與類相關的功能,同時又不需要實例化對象。這樣可以將一些通用的功能邏輯封裝在靜態方法中,方便重用和維護。

需要注意的是,靜態方法不能直接訪問非靜態成員變量和非靜態方法,只能通過實例化對象來訪問。此外,靜態方法也不能被子類重寫,只能被繼承和調用。

0
陕西省| 德庆县| 射阳县| 航空| 留坝县| 客服| 洛扎县| 武冈市| 临朐县| 辽中县| 青川县| 鹤壁市| 香河县| 南溪县| 迁安市| 万载县| 万源市| 陵川县| 淮安市| 修文县| 琼中| 潞城市| 镇雄县| 宿迁市| 阆中市| 吉木萨尔县| 桑植县| 仲巴县| 治县。| 开江县| 偃师市| 海阳市| 龙游县| 巴彦淖尔市| 南阳市| 河源市| 宝鸡市| 嵩明县| 慈溪市| 玛曲县| 莆田市|